The emerald gem plant, also known as the emerald arborvitae, is an evergreen shrub that is popular for its vibrant green foliage. If you’re looking to keep your emerald gem plant healthy and thriving, fertilization is crucial. In this guide, we’ll go over everything you need to know about fertilizing your emerald gem plant.
Why Fertilize Your Emerald Gem Plant?
Fertilizing your emerald gem plant provides it with the essential nutrients it needs to grow strong and healthy. Without proper fertilization, your plant may struggle to grow and develop properly. Additionally, fertilization can help your emerald gem plant resist disease and pests.
When to Fertilize Your Emerald Gem Plant
The best time to fertilize your emerald gem plant is in the spring, just before new growth begins. You can also fertilize in the fall after the plant has stopped growing for the season. It’s important not to fertilize during the winter months when the plant is dormant.
Choosing the Right Fertilizer
When choosing a fertilizer for your emerald gem plant, look for a balanced fertilizer with a ratio of n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ium (NPK) of 10-10-10 or 20-20-20. These ratios provide your plant with the necessary nutrients for healthy growth.
How to Apply Fertilizer
To apply fertilizer to your emerald gem plant, start by reading the instructions on the package carefully. Generally, you’ll want to apply the fertilizer evenly around the base of the plant, making sure not to get any on the foliage. Water thoroughly after applying fertilizer.
Additional Tips for Fertilizing Your Emerald Gem Plant
- Avoid over-fertilizing your emerald gem plant, as this can lead to burnt foliage and root damage.
- Don’t fertilize your plant if it is stressed or suffering from disease or pest infestation.
- Always follow the instructions on the fertilizer package carefully to avoid damaging your plant.
FAQ
How often should I fertilize my emerald gem plant?
You should fertilize your emerald gem plant once a year in the spring or fall, depending on when the plant is actively growing.
Can I use any type of fertilizer on my emerald gem plant?
No, not all fertilizers are suitable for emerald gem plants. Look for a balanced fertilizer with an NPK ratio of 10-10-10 or 20-20-20.
What happens if I over-fertilize my emerald gem plant?
Over-fertilizing your emerald gem plant can lead to burnt foliage and root damage. It’s important to follow the instructions on the fertilizer package carefully.
My emerald gem plant is not growing well. Should I fertilize it more frequently?
No, fertilizing your emerald gem plant too frequently can actually harm it. If your plant is not growing well, check to make sure it is getting adequate water and sunlight, and consider consulting with a gardening expert.
